Distance From Beverly Airport to Boca Raton Public Airport (BVY - BCT Distance)
The flight distance from Beverly Airport (BVY) to Boca Raton Public Airport (BCT) is 1235 miles. This is equivalent to 1987 kilometers or 1072 nautical miles. The distance shown below is the straight line distance (may be called as flying or air distance) or direct flight distance between airports.

Flight Duration between Beverly, United States and Boca Raton, United States
Estimated flight time from Beverly Airport, Beverly, United States to Boca Raton Public Airport, Boca Raton, United States is 2 hours 28 minutes under avarage conditions. The flight time calculator assumes an average flight speed for a commercial airliner of 500 mph, which is equivalent to 805 km/hr or 434 knots. Your actual flying time may vary depending on wind speeds or weather conditions.
